Requirements
  • A bachelor's degree in medical laboratory science, medical technology, laboratory science, or a related scientific field is required.
  • At least five years of laboratory experience in a clinical or anatomic laboratory is required.
  • At least three years of management, supervisory, or leadership experience in a laboratory is required.
  • ASCP certification is required.
  • Extensive knowledge of anatomic pathology laboratory operations, quality systems, and regulatory requirements is required.
  • Demonstrated experience in budgeting, fiscal management, and operational improvement is required.
  • Strong understanding of laboratory quality assurance, method validation, and compliance requirements is required.
  • The candidate must be able to maintain confidentiality regarding patients and team members.
  • The candidate must be able to withstand crisis situations.
  • Knowledge and experience with electronic health records are required.
  • ASCP medical technologist or medical laboratory technician credentials are required.
Responsibilities
  • Direct and manage all aspects of Anatomic Pathology laboratory operations and laboratory support services.
  • Plan, organize, implement, and evaluate laboratory services to ensure efficient and effective operations.
  • Collaborate with pathologists, physicians, and hospital leaders to support patient care, service excellence, and strategic objectives.
  • Interface effectively with all hospital departments as a member of the management team.
  • Ensure compliance with applicable regulatory, accreditation, and organizational requirements, including College of American Pathologists standards, policies, and procedures.
  • Oversee performance improvement and quality assurance programs.
  • Ensure that test methodologies provide the quality of results necessary for patient care.
  • Verify that validation and verification procedures establish accuracy, precision, and other key performance characteristics.
  • Ensure laboratory personnel perform testing according to established procedures to maintain accurate and reliable results.
  • Ensure appropriate corrective and remedial actions are implemented and documented when significant deviations from established performance specifications occur.
  • Ensure patient test results are reported only when laboratory systems are functioning properly and meet quality standards.
  • Manage departmental budgets and resources effectively.
  • Participate in budget planning, financial forecasting, and identification of growth opportunities.
  • Monitor expenses and implement strategies to optimize operational performance and resource utilization.
  • Direct personnel management, including recruitment, onboarding, performance management, coaching, employee engagement, and staff development.
  • Foster a culture of accountability, teamwork, and continuous improvement.
  • Lead change management initiatives and make timely operational decisions.
  • Communicate with laboratory team members, pathologists, physicians, and organizational leadership.
  • Serve as a consultant to physicians and department leaders regarding laboratory findings and services.
  • Provide technical expertise, guidance, and support to laboratory leadership and staff as needed.

Beebe Healthcare To Deploy Epic Enterprise Ehr Across Network

Beebe Healthcare to Deploy Epic Enterprise EHR Across Network. by Fred Pennic 07/17/2024 Leave a Comment. What You Should Know: – Beebe Healthcare, a comprehensive healthcare system serving Sussex County, Delaware, and the surrounding region announced a strategic partnership with Epic, a leading healthcare software company, to implement its enterprise electronic health record (EHR) system. This move aims to deliver a more seamless and integrated care experience for patients across Sussex County.– Currently, Beebe Healthcare operates on separate EHR platforms for its Medical Group and Oncology Services. By adopting Epic as its single, comprehensive EHR system, Beebe will create a unified patient record, improving care coordination and efficiency.Epic EHR ImpactEpic’s robust platform, serving over 2,900 hospitals and 280 million patients, was selected due to its strong functional capabilities and high patient satisfaction scores. This transition will enable Beebe to offer a full spectrum of patient health records, including ambulatory health, revenue cycle management, data analytics, and business intelligence, all within a single system.Implementation TimelineThe implementation of Epic is expected to be completed by 2025
